At this very moment I'm listening to the second movement (7:56) of Glenn Branca's Symphony No. 1 (Tonal Plexus).
This is some scary crap.
It sounds like a gamelan orchestra...whose member are all insane.
There are weird electric guitar clanks, spouting horns and martial percussion bits. Phew! This is "world gone crazy" music.
Turn it up very loud, pour yourself and nice Lagavulin, and pretend that the bomb has just dropped.
